Company mission

Hivemapper's mission is to make an accessible global map, built by all of us.

Our take

When Hivemapper launched in 2015, it focused on creating 3D maps for drone pilots, but in the last few years its set its sights on a much more ambitious target – to decentralize how maps are produced.

It’s aiming to do this by way of a dashcam and community owned, blockchain-based mapping network. Essentially, drivers purchase the dashcam, which mines and earns them Hivemapper’s own cryptocurrency, HONEY, in exchange for building maps while they drive.

Considering that Google Maps, the world’s most popular navigation system, is slow to update its street views - especially in remote areas - Hivemapper could be onto something with it close-to-real-time network. It remains too early to tell if Hivemapper’s coins will become truly valuable in time, but the considerable funds the company has raised from crypto-focussed investors surely displays its strong potential.

Company values

  • Have empathy and candor – We are thoughtful of other perspectives and we give others the benefit of the doubt. We speak our minds but always with respect and intellectual honesty. We understand that listening unlocks more than talking, and we strive to be good listeners. We support others to be successful in their journeys.
  • Go a bit over the speed limit – We are ambitious. We are constantly asking ourselves “what is my next level?”. We believe that it is better to ask for forgiveness than ask for permission, yet we won’t be reckless.
  • Own the problem – We do what it takes to deliver. We herd the cats to drive our projects forward. We strive to articulate a vision or define the problem and rally others to solve it.
  • Always be inventing – We are iterative. We are resilient. We are curious. We don’t fear the messiness.
  • Be bold – Nobody ever won by thinking and acting small.
  • Wear the customer’s shoes – We get into the customer’s mindset. We go to the customer to learn how they work. We observe and listen.
  • Be proud of what you ship – We care about our work. We are making something that we want to use and are proud of recommending.
